Publisher's Synopsis

De Jure Belli Ac Pacis Libri Tres est opus magnum a Hugo Grotio, jurisconsulto et philosopho Hollandiae, scriptum. In hoc libro, auctor tractat de jure naturae et gentium, et de legibus belli et pacis. Grotius argumentat quod bellum non est licitum nisi in casu defensionis, et quod pacis conservatio est finis ultimus societatis humanae. Praeterea, auctor describit conditiones pacis, et quomodo bellum et pacem inter gentes regi debent. De Jure Belli Ac Pacis Libri Tres est consideratum ut una ex principaliis operibus iuris internationalis, et fuit valde influentiale in formando leges belli et pacis in Europa.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
